Why a Nasal Spray? The Science Behind the Hype

What makes this particularly fascinating is the spray’s approach. Instead of targeting a single virus like traditional vaccines, INNA-051 activates the body’s innate immune system. It’s like upgrading your antivirus software to handle any threat, not just the latest strain. Professor Nathan Bartlett, the virologist leading this research, explains it as boosting the body’s natural defenses at the point of entry—the nose.

From my perspective, this is a brilliant shift in strategy. Respiratory viruses like flu, RSV, and COVID-19 are masters of adaptation. They evolve faster than we can develop vaccines. A broad-spectrum solution like this could be the key to staying one step ahead. But here’s the kicker: it all started as an accident. Researchers at Melbourne’s Doherty Institute were working on something entirely different when they noticed the compound’s antiviral potential. Science, as always, is full of happy accidents.

From Lab to Life: The Long Road to Clinical Trials

One thing that immediately stands out is the sheer amount of work behind this. Bartlett and his team spent five years on preclinical research, testing the compound against everything from rhinoviruses to SARS-CoV-2. What many people don’t realize is how rare it is for a lab discovery to make it this far. Most promising treatments get stuck in the “valley of death” between research and clinical trials.

The fact that INNA-051 has secured $46 million in funding and is now in Phase 2 trials in the U.S. is a testament to its potential. But it’s also a reminder of how much is at stake. If successful, this could protect millions of vulnerable people—elderly adults, young children, and those with chronic conditions. Yet, as Bartlett notes, it’s not just about the science. It’s about translating that science into something doctors can use.
